Taco Bell Testing Two New Premium Chicken Tortadas?

A recent trip to our local Taco Bell in Costa Mesa, CA found us stumbling upon two Premium Chicken Tortadas we hadn’t seen yet. In May of last year, Taco Bell introduced the Tortadas line with Bacon Ranch and Salsa Roja varieties. Today, we get a peak at a Chicken Guacamole Tortada and a Chipotle Chicken Tortada.

The new items carried a $2.49 price tag, and were definitely tasty. The outer tortilla shell was crispy, and the innards were juicy and had a nice balance of flavors. Unlike some of the other Taco Bell items, after finishing the Chicken Guacamole Tortada, I wasn’t feeling too bloated, which is always a plus.
